A 2014 meta-analysis of 23 randomized controlled tests entailing 1,255 individuals revealed a lower threat of mortality or re-hospitalization in the long-term for people that went through a stem cell therapy for heart problem. In spite of some appealing outcomes, the varied material and character of these research studies and the limited understanding of standard principles, pathways and various other aspects have slowed down progression, particularly as it relates to the one of the most complex muscular tissues in the body. Many of these research studies were in the processing of completing phase II and some were even moving right into stage III. Today, more and much more professional tests utilizing stem cells like those located in cable tissue are being used to deal with heart illness.

A number of kinds of stem cells have actually been explored for their possibility in cardio treatment, including: These cells are originated from embryos and have the capacity to differentiate into any type of cell type. However, their usage is restricted because of ethical issues and the threat of teratoma formation. These cells are produced from adult cells that are reprogrammed to have pluripotent capacities similar to ESCs.



MSCs are grown-up stem cells that can be separated from various tissues, consisting of bone marrow, adipose tissue, and umbilical cable. They have been commonly utilized in cardio treatment as a result of their capacity to set apart into various cell kinds and their immunomodulatory buildings. CSCs are a kind of adult stem cell that is resident in the heart.
